Splits the user module out of the Ordelay monolith into `user-core`. Auth, profile, and preferences now live behind an internal RPC boundary; the monolith keeps a thin shim for one release. No schema changes. Rollback is a config flip. Connection pooling and retry behavior for the new service are governed by the constants below.

constants for bagag-fawip:
BUDGETS = {
    "wenius": 400,
    "brieth": 224,
    "rusath": 783,
    "eliys": 187,
    "aldax": 737,
    "ralion": 818,
    "istius": 153,
}

Hello Orvandel partner team,

Welcome aboard — this note covers the basics of the Hollyvend restock planner integration for anyone new. The planner ingests machine telemetry overnight, builds route-level restock plans by 06:00 local, and exposes them through the partner API. Please read the field glossary before mapping SKUs, since unit casing differs from our older feeds. When you're ready to pull your first plan, authenticate with the bearer token below.

session JWT of yawep-yawep = eyJhbGciOiJIUzI1NiIsInR5cCI6IkpXVCJ9.eyJzdWIiOiI3pWF3_In0.aXYsHiog

Finance Review Summary — Logistics Transition

Switching from Harwell Freight to Cindermoor Logistics cuts per-shipment cost 12% and improves delivery reliability in the Velstan corridor. One-time migration cost recovered within two quarters. Contract penalties with Harwell are immaterial. Treasury confirms no covenant impact. Risk team flags minor onboarding exposure, mitigated by phased rollout. The confidential note below outlines related plans.

internal memo for hahif-hahaf: Headcount on the Zorwyn team goes from 9 to 100 by the end of October. Gross margin on Zorwyn came in at 5 percent against a plan of 10 percent.

**Mgmt Meeting Minutes — Retiring the Brightline Range**

Quick recap for sales leads at Fenholt Supplies: we agreed to retire the Brightline fixture range by year-end. Remaining stock moves to clearance pricing next month, and accounts on standing orders get migrated to the Lumetta range. Trade-in incentives were approved in principle. The confidential note on next steps sits just below.

board note of bajof-bajeg: The pricing group signed off on a budget of $13.4 million for Project Sildor. The renewal with Lamixek Holdings closes at $48.9 million a year, 49 percent above the last contract.